    <description>The Appellate Tribunal CESTAT ALLAHABAD allowed the appellant to avail Cenvat Credit on Excise duty paid on Welding Electrodes used for repair and maintenance of capital goods in a sugar manufacturing factory. The Tribunal referenced previous decisions supporting the eligibility of such credit for maintenance activities, emphasizing the importance of consistency and legal precedents in determining admissibility. The appeals were granted, overturning the Orders-in-Original and Orders-in-Appeal, affirming the admissibility of Cenvat credit for welding electrodes in repair and maintenance processes.</description>
